How Much Speed does a The Plot Household Need?
Higher speed is typically preferred, but that comes at a higher price. The average size of a household in The Plot is 2.3, which is smaller than the Scranton average of 2.4 and smaller than the national average of 2.7. The Plot's average household income is $59,123 which is higher than the Scranton average of $54,557 and lower than the national average of $90,606. Homes with fewer people living in them and with lower incomes tend to indicate fewer devices being used less often.
The Plot also has 16% of its population enrolled in school between the 6th grade and college level, this is lower than the Scranton average of 19%. Additionally, 6% of residents work from home, which is lower than the 9% of residents in Scranton who work from home. This and other factors you can see above show us that the community of The Plot has an average need for internet connectivity and speeds.
Compared to the rest of the country, The Plot households are more technology-disengaged. 90% of households have some sort of computing device, 73% have desktops or laptops in the home, and 87% have smartphones. To see what speeds you are currently getting, please visit our internet speed test tool.
Which Fiber Internet Providers are Available in The Plot?
North Penn Fiber in The Plot, Scranton, PA
North Penn offers Fiber service to 63.5%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, North Penn Fiber is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 1,000 Mbps
EarthLink Fiber in The Plot, Scranton, PA
EarthLink offers Fiber service to 62.3%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, EarthLink Fiber has speeds up to 3,537 Mbps, with speeds from 2,048 Mpbs up to 5,000 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ds are symmetrical, meaning they are exactly the same as download speeds for EarthLink Fiber. EarthLink Fiber is rated about the same as other types of internet service available in The Plot from EarthLink in terms of customer satisfaction.
Verizon Fiber in The Plot, Scranton, PA
Verizon offers Fiber service to 62.3%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, Verizon Fiber has speeds up to 2,048 Mbps
AT&T Fiber in The Plot, Scranton, PA
AT&T offers Fiber service to 31.4%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, AT&T Fiber has speeds up to 5,000 Mbps
Astound Broadband Fiber in The Plot, Scranton, PA
Astound Broadband offers Fiber service to 21.8%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, Astound Broadband Fiber is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 1,500 Mbps
Which Cable Internet Providers are Available in The Plot?
XFINITY Cable in The Plot, Scranton, PA
XFINITY from Comcast offers Cable service to 93.7%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, XFINITY Cable is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 1,815 Mbps, with speeds from 1,200 Mpbs up to 2,000 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ds differ from download speeds, and are as low 35 and as high as 250, with an average of 200 Mbps throughout the neighborhood.
Which DSL Internet Providers are Available in The Plot?
Frontier DSL in The Plot, Scranton, PA
Frontier Communications offers DSL service to 30.7%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, Frontier DSL is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 10 Mbps
Which Fixed Wireless and LTE Internet Providers are Available in The Plot?
ICON Technologies Fixed Wireless in The Plot, Scranton, PA
ICON Technologies offers Fixed Wireless service to 91.9%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, ICON Technologies Fixed Wireless is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 100 Mbps
SkyPacket Networks Fixed Wireless in The Plot, Scranton, PA
SkyPacket Networks offers Fixed Wireless service to 88.0%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, SkyPacket Networks Fixed Wireless is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 25 Mbps
EarthLink Fixed Wireless in The Plot, Scranton, PA
EarthLink offers Fixed Wireless service to 83.7%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, EarthLink Fixed Wireless has speeds up to 65 Mbps, with speeds from 25 Mpbs up to 100 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ds differ from download speeds, and are as low 3.0 and as high as 20, with an average of 12 Mbps throughout the neighborhood.
AT&T Fixed Wireless in The Plot, Scranton, PA
AT&T offers Fixed Wireless service to 83.7%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, AT&T Fixed Wireless has speeds up to 65 Mbps, with speeds from 25 Mpbs up to 100 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ds differ from download speeds, and are as low 3.0 and as high as 20, with an average of 12 Mbps throughout the neighborhood.
T-Mobile Home Internet Fixed Wireless in The Plot, Scranton, PA
T-Mobile Home Internet offers Fixed Wireless service to 83.7%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, T-Mobile Home Internet Fixed Wireless is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 58 Mbps, with speeds from 25 Mpbs up to 100 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ds differ from download speeds, and are as low 3.0 and as high as 20, with an average of 10 Mbps throughout the neighborhood.
Verizon Fixed Wireless in The Plot, Scranton, PA
Verizon offers Fixed Wireless service to 56.4% of The Plot homes. Across the neighborhood, Verizon Fixed Wireless has speeds up to 300 Mbps
